One kiss from the most popular boy in school and Chandler turns into a frog!

Once upon a time, there was a suburban "princess" named Chandler. She had everything money could buy -- except what she really wanted. An orphan since the age of nine, Chandler longs for someone to like her, not for her money, not for her heated swimming pool, but for herself. Then one day, the cutest boy in school asks her for a kiss. Just when Chandler thinks her dreams will come true -- Danny's kiss changes her into a frog! Now she has to rely on Danny to help find the cure for this all-too-real curse! Will Chandler return to life as she knows it or forever be a frog?
